C82500 Copper vs. ACI-ASTM CF10SMnN Steel

C82500 copper belongs to the copper alloys classification, while ACI-ASTM CF10SMnN steel belongs to the iron alloys. There are 23 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(9,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is C82500 copper and the bottom bar is ACI-ASTM CF10SMnN steel.
